There is disclosed a bag web for packing articles in film bags provided as a contiguous web. At an opening edge, the bag web is provided with peripheral strip areas having holes intended for guide connection with guide means that can retain and guide the bags along a conveyor path through a filling station. The bag items will thus be contiguous along an upper edge, which is used for guiding. The bag webs include the film webs forming opposing front and back sides of the bag and additional film pieces disposed between the flat sides of the bag in order thereby to form side or bottom, or both side and bottom, of the bag. By such a bag web is achieved a particularly simple and rapid filling of the type with stand bottom and with folded side edges.

An adjustable tunnel for a bagging machine that enables a variety of bag sizes to be fitted to the tunnel is disclosed. The adjustable tunnel has a height adjustable overhead panel, an adjustable width base, a first and second side panel, a first and second intermediate panel, and a surface tensioning assembly.

This invention is an apparatus that, connected to a computer program, controls the process of filling of pills in trays for medicine dispensers or pillboxes with multiple chambers. The apparatus is characterized by applying a control scanner and a precision weight for precise dispensing of the pills and by gate templates to guide the pills to selected chambers in the target pillboxes. Target chambers are automatically selected according to the pre-determined ingestion time. The pills will remain in the gate-template until the operator has conducted a visual inspection and/or performed a semi-automatic camera control to verify that the pills are properly distributed in the openings of the gate template. After the verification process, the pills are released into medication tray, by means of a mechanical device with double barrier plates, which are activated by a specialized release mechanism.

A method and apparatus for producing multi-compartment water-soluble pouches 38 from a base web 27 and a lidding web 35 is disclosed. The apparatus includes a rotatable former 21 having compartment forming cavities 23 into which the base web 27 can be formed. The former 21 is configured so that compartments 26,29,32 of a pouch 38 can be formed and filled sequentially and thereafter all compartments 26,29,32 closed and sealed by affixing the lidding web 35 to the base web 27.

A nicotine-containing pharmaceutical product configured for insertion into the mouth of a user of that product is provided. The product can have an outer water-permeable pouch, a nicotine- containing pharmaceutical composition situated within the outer water-permeable pouch, and product identifying information relating to the nicotine-containing pharmaceutical composition. The information can be presented such that a user of the product can discern the identifying information by visually inspecting the product and thereby differentiate or identify certain nicotine- containing pharmaceutical products. The product identifying can be, for example, printed, imprinted or dyed on the outer water-permeable pouch, positioned within the outer water- permeable pouch, or attached to the outer water-permeable pouch. The product identifying information can identify product brand, a company name, a corporate logo or brand, marketing messages, product strength, active ingredient, product manufacture date, product expiration date, product flavor, product pharmaceutical release profile, weight, product code, other product differentiating markings, and combinations thereof.
